Riverfront apartment project in doubt after commissioners hear criticisms of St. Louis developer

Port Authority of Kansas City commissioners did not move forward with plans to award Lux Living tax incentives on a $55 million deal to develop apartments on the Berkley Riverfront after news stories detailed the developer’s past in St. Louis.

Port KC may award tax breaks for $55M apartment project, despite St. Louis developer's murky record

As details emerge about Lux Living’s legal battles and complaints from its St. Louis property residents, Port Authority members gave a nod to the embattled developer. But one council member isn’t convinced.
